About The Position

Repairs, installs and performs preventive maintenance on all production equipment to ensure that such equipment is in good operable condition at all times. Uses electrical and mechanical expertise to trouble shoot, repair, install and perform preventive and interactive maintenance on all production equipment accessories to ensure that all equipment is in good operable condition at all times.

Requirements

  • High School Diploma, GED or Equivalent preferred.
  • 4 years of industrial maintenance/electrical experience required.
  • Knowledge of local, state and federal electric codes
  • Able to read and make proper installations of complex electrical circuits from wiring diagrams.
  • Able to disassemble, repair and reassemble gear boxes, fans conveyors, blowers, compressors, pumps, valves, furnaces, drives and all allied mechanical equipment related to electrical troubleshooting
  • Experience troubleshooting and repairing oven combustion and safety devices.
  • Possesses working knowledge of hydraulic, compressed air systems and be able to read complex diagrams and troubleshoot these systems
  • Experience Installing and repairing pneumatic conduit, cables, piping, and tubing, including all necessary connections, controls and grounding.
  • Possess working knowledge of the following equipment:
  • MIG/TIG/ARC welding equipment.
  • Gas & Plasma cutting equipment
  • Power tools such as drill presses, cut off saw, lathes, mills, and table tools.
  • Electrical test equipment such as voltmeter, megger, ammeter, diode and SCR tester.
